Fewer people google "best real estate agent in Toronto" and scroll a page of links. They ask ChatGPT, Perplexity or Gemini and get three names back. No page two. If your realtor practice isn't one of the three, that Toronto buyer never even sees you.
That answer isn't your website ranking. The AI synthesizes it from the sources it trusts across the web: Google Business Profile, reviews, directories and structured data. A brand-new or lightly-reviewed realtor has nothing for the model to pull from, so it recommends the real estate agents that do.

AI visibility for real estate agents, answered.
Why does AI recommend other agents instead of me?
AI names the agents with the strongest signals: a complete Google Business Profile, strong client reviews, consistent listings and structured data. Agents who have built those get recommended before you do.
How does a real estate agent get recommended by AI?
Optimize your Google Business Profile, collect real client reviews, keep consistent listings across real estate and local directories, add structured data, and publish content answering the questions buyers and sellers ask.
Do client reviews affect an agent's AI visibility?
Significantly. Choosing an agent is a high-trust decision, so AI weighs reviews heavily. A strong, recent review profile is one of the biggest levers for getting named.
Is this the same as real estate SEO?
It is broader. SEO ranks your site in Google links. AI visibility relies more on off-site signals, your profile, reviews, citations and answer content, so the AI recommends you by name.
